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
215 70 199489 528902
2425206 22677
2425206 22677
7110155 46694 670636
All about undefined
Interested in learning more?
2425206 22677
7110155 46694 670636
See more
2934558 3560
061401 35987 750923 90390686347
See more
3845651 43
6750068 4616426 97212685
See more